Frontier Co-op Organic Adobo Seasoning, Sea Salt with Organic Garlic, Onion, Black Pepper, Oregano, Bay Leaf, Turmeric
Based on the gluten-free tagging and gluten-free-leaning ingredient list (garlic, onion, pepper, oregano, bay leaf, turmeric, sea salt), plus Certified Organic status, the product is likely safe for many people avoiding gluten. However, explicit cross-contact information and formal GF certification beyond tagging are not clearly documented.

Product snapshot
Frontier Co-op Organic Adobo Seasoning is a sea-salt-based spice blend that lists Organic Garlic, Organic Onion, Organic Black Pepper, Organic Oregano, Organic Bay Leaf, and Organic Turmeric. The product data emphasizes its organic status and notes that the blend is Non Irradiated. It carries gluten-free tagging in the supplied data, and the ingredients shown are garlic, onion, peppers, oregano, bay leaf, and turmeric, with sea salt as the base. The price is listed at $7.29 for 2.86 oz, and the product has a high rating (4.7) from a substantial number of reviews (1952).
Flavor, texture, and kitchen uses
Flavor is described as garlic- and onion-forward with a balanced spice mix that includes turmeric. It is marketed as versatile for a range of dishes, from meats to soups. Some buyers report enjoying the authentic adobo flavor and the convenience of an all-in-one seasoning.
Gluten safety, certifications, and consumer notes
Gluten safety is supported by a labeled gluten-free tag and the product’s organic status; however, explicit cross-contact details and formal gluten-free certification beyond tagging are not clearly documented in the supplied sources. The product lists Certified Organic as a certification in the gluten assessment data, and the ingredient list shows garlic, onion, pepper, oregano, bay leaf, and turmeric as gluten-free by composition.
